Beginning Friday, November 15, people will have the opportunity to receive assistance in tracing their genealogy at the La Porte County Public Library’s Main location in La Porte.
Mary Wenzel, a local genealogist, will volunteer every Friday from 10am to 12pm beginning on the 15th in the Indiana Room at the Main Library. She will help people research their family history by finding the information they need in books, on the computer, and on microfilm. Even though Library staff is available to help with genealogy at all times the library is open, this is a special time for people to come in for help.
